Contractor Registration

Updated Info for Registration Renewals for 2022!
Summary of Changes:

1) New Streamlined Permit Fees
Review our new streamlined permit fee schedule - effective Jan 1, 2022. 
2) New Online Permitting System
We are currently implementing a new permitting software system, BS&A. During this initial phase of implementation, we are enabling the following simple permits to be applied for, tracked, paid for and inspection requested online

  • Air Conditioner
  • Furnace
  • Radon Mitigation
  • Roof
  • Sewer Repair
  • Water Heater
  • Window Replacement

At this time, all other permits will be serviced via our traditional methods.
Please note that contractors must register for a BS&A Online Account to utilize the online capabilities.

  • Creating an account is quick and easy – to create an account click here.
  • Once you are registered as a contractor you can apply for and access multiple permits under that one account.
  • Already have an account with BS&A? Go ahead and login! You can utilize the same account in any other community that uses BS&A – there is no need to create separate accounts for each municipality. Simply ask us for the Web PIN to link your current account to our records.
  • Check out the Contractor Learning Center for more information and tutorials.

3) Simple Contractor Registration
The contractor registration fee is now a flat $75 per trade (with the exception of those who hold State of Illinois licenses).
Key info:

  • Registration renewal. All current contractor registrations will expire on Dec. 31st. The Village is now accepting renewals for the 2022 registration year.
  • Forms and fees. Please complete the Contractor Registration Application and return it along with all applicable licenses and fees. Registrations must include all of the requirements be considered complete. The Village will not process incomplete Registration Applications.
  • Accepted payment methods are cash, check, or credit card (except AmEx); however, there is an additional processing fee for credit card payments.
  • Required Licenses.
    • The following State licensed contractors must provide a copy of the current State of Illinois license: Alarm, Elevator, Fire Suppression, Irrigation, Plumbing, Radon, and Roof. There is no registration fee for state licensed contractors.
    • Plumbing: Plumbing contractors must provide a copy of their current State of Illinois (058-) or City of Chicago license and their State of Illinois Plumbing Contractor Registration (055-).
    • Electrical: Electrical contractors must provide a copy of their current electrical registration/license. The Village honors registrations of any Illinois municipalities that requires a written exam prior to the issuance of the license/registration.
  • Registration forms, licenses, and checks can be:
Building Department
Village of Buffalo Grove
50 Raupp Blvd.
Buffalo Grove, IL 60089

Dropped off:
In-person at Village Hall (50 Raupp Blvd, Buffalo Grove)
Mon 8am to 6:30pm
Tue through Fri 8am to 4:30pm
Via 24-hour drop box in the parking lot at Village Hall

Project guidelines, applications, and more can be accessed at

The Village requires registration for all contractors. 

Frequently Asked Questions

Do I need to be registered with the Village?
How do I register/renew my registration?
Sandy at front counter1

Who's Listening?

Community Development Department

Hours: 8:30 am - 4:30 pm Monday through Friday